At Amazon, we are working to be the most Customer-centric company on earth and as part of that we’re constantly looking at taking to a new level in how we fulfil and deliver customer orders. We are building a world-class last mile operation, significantly complemented by Delivery Service Partners (DSP). Amazon works directly with DSPs to make deliveries to our customers.
We are looking for an Insight Analyst to join the EU Last Mile DSP Network Health Team. This person will need to work closely with senior leaders in the Last Mile space as well as key partner organizations to ensure success. The Insight Analyst will collaborate on building, executing, and reporting partners insights for Network Health (NH) and the Delivery Service Partners program. This includes working closely with legal, account managers, operations, tech, and other internal teams to build and refine models to better understand our DSP partners.

Key Job Responsibilities
1. Owning reporting for strategic roadmaps by working with business leaders; driving expansion and optimization of new business units in our DSP program.
2. Developing and maintaining performance dashboards with key metrics for review with senior leadership and business teams; synthesizing large quantities of data to help create new, step-change initiatives for the organization.
3. Onboarding data to our data warehouse by building automated data pipelines utilizing e.g., Python in Lambda or SageMaker to invoke API calls.
4. Using statistical techniques and tools for strategic deep dives; generating actionable insights and effectively communicating recommendations to senior leadership.
5. Inventing new ways to analyze data to identify the trends and gaps in the experience and services we provide to our delivery service partners.
6. Partnering with other data engineers and analysts to build and automate central tools that will improve the quality of reporting and analysis in the organization.
7. Partner with our global teams, align on reporting needs, setup, maintain, and own data pipelines.
8. Create SOPs and drive process improvements.
9. Ensures critical path timelines are met, resource needs are understood, and project prioritization is visible to senior leadership.
About the Team
The Network Health team is part of the wider EU DSP organization. Our role is to work closely with our stakeholders in assessing the health of our business partners (i.e., the network) and how we can improve the 'win-win' collaboration with our DSPs while improving performance and compliance.
